Baby, It's cold outside...-Lady Antebellum or James Taylor and Natalie Cole
This is an old slow song Christmas favorite. Lady Antebellum among many others have done covers of this song which was originally performed by Frank Loesser and his wife at a housewarming party.
All I want for Christmas is You- Mariah Carey
Santa Baby-Eartha Kitt
This is a classic slow song for Christmas originally performed by Eartha Kitt. It has since been covered by Mariah Carey, Everclear, Macy Gray, Natalie Merchant, Taylor Swift and The Pussycat Dolls.
Slow Dance- The Carpenters
Slow Dance is a song that lives up to its name. It was written and recorded by Richard and Karen Carpenter for a 10th anniversary album that never came to pass. It was resurrected in 1989 and released on the album "Lovelines".
